摘要: Bud germination rate and emergence uniformity are critical agronomic traits for sugarcane production, as they directly influence raw cane consumption during planting and the formation of ratooning ability. In this study, we employed integrated transcriptomic and metabolomic analyses to explore the molecular factors that distinguish successful from failed bud germination in field-grown cultivar YZ08-1609 across key developmental stages. Our multi-omics profiling and functional enrichment analysis highlighted critical pathway networks, including carbohydrate metabolism, phytohormone biosynthesis and signaling, plant-pathogen interactions and MAPK cascades (MEKK1, WRKY24/35), and ROS-hormonal crosstalk (RBOHB, ERF094, ACS6). Notably, weighted gene coexpression network analysis (WGCNA) identified two germination-promoting modules enriched with proline-rich protein genes (TPRP-F1, PRP4), cell wall remodeling factor (WAT1), ethylene biosynthesis genes (MAO1Bs), and histone modifiers (Histone H2B.5, etc.), as well as two germination-inhibiting modules dominated by methylation regulator (OMT3), defence-related genes (Barwin, Zlp) and flavonoid biosynthetic factors (CHS1, ANR). Further mechanism studies showed that these modules coordinate the growth-defence balance through four interconnected mechanisms: (i) metabolic balance between the production and consumption of ROS, (ii) epigenetic chromatin reorganization via histone modifications, (iii) methylation-driven transcriptional regulation, and (iv) phytoalexin-dependent pathogen resistance. Overall, this study provides the first detailed map of the molecular networks governing sugarcane bud germination.
